Method: Rugged::Reference#log?

Defined in:
ext/rugged/rugged_reference.c

#log?Boolean

Return true if the reference has a reflog, false otherwise.

Returns:

  • (Boolean)


335
336
337
338
339
340
341
342
343
344
# File 'ext/rugged/rugged_reference.c', line 335

static VALUE rb_git_has_reflog(VALUE self)
{
	git_reference *ref;
	git_repository *repo;

	Data_Get_Struct(self, git_reference, ref);
	repo = git_reference_owner(ref);

	return git_reference_has_log(repo, git_reference_name(ref)) ? Qtrue : Qfalse;
}